What You'll Do
- →Incumbent performs duties under the verbal and written direction of the facility director.
- →Assistance and guidance is normally available at all times.
- →Work is reviewed in terms of results achieved IAW standards and procedures.
- →Responsible for the operation of the Child and Youth Services (CYS) Homework Center in accordance with applicable regulations.
- →As part of the on ratio staff, provides assistance to participants in strengthening their academic and learning skills.
- →Develops linkages with parents, School Liaison Officer, other CYS Program Associates and volunteer tutors to ensure homework center is fully integrated into all applicable program settings.
- →Plans, coordinates, and conducts activities for program participants based on observed needs of individual children/youth.
- →Models appropriate behaviors and techniques for working with children/youth.
- →Works with senior staff to provide instruction and training to lower level employees on working in the homework center.
- →Provides input to CYS training plan based on observed training needs.
- →Secures supplies, equipment, and facilities.
